From left, Lake City High School senior Celi Barron, junior Matheu Myers and sophomore Jackie Dalleska prefer to eat in the hallways at school because the cafeteria is too crowded. The students have also struggled with other overcrowding issues such as crowded classrooms and teachers who dont have a permanent classroom. The bond the Coeur dAlene School District is putting to the voters in March would add classroom space to Lake City High School.
